Game Play:
The contestants were two couples who were invited to use observation and deduction to choose which of three options (X, Y or Z) was the correct solution to a given problem. Usually, this involved other people of which only one was genuine, in a style similar to "To Tell The Truth".
Devised by Mark Goodson and Bill Todman.
Broadcast History:
CBS Daytime 06/30/1958 to 01/02/1959
ABC Daytime 01/05/1959 to 05/08/1959
NBC Daytime 12/07/1959 to 09/27/1963
NBC Primetime 04/15/1960 to 09/23/1960
NBC Primetime 06/20/1962 to 09/26/1962
Board games for "at home playing" were marketed.
In 1962, there was also a U.K. version of this show on BBC.less «
